The leveling system in Destiny doesn't reflect as simply, like it used to. It's now shown only in light. Being a level 40 just doesn't make a difference aside from what gear we can equip . It's just an unnecessary number that sits above all of our characters' heads. It only truly matters for lower level players.
Previously this game reflected leveling through the armor you wore, the light was attached to just that one aspect. Other players could easily understand how much work you put in to attain that gear, and there was no way to misconcieve it.
My suggestion is to seperate the guardian level with a number as it functioned before the taken king. This means you know how up to current thier armor/gear is.
Weapons you carry will reflect in a seperate overall light level. It then becomes easier to understand how effective a player can be with their overall arsenal.
In PvE this makes more sense. A guardians armor level can help determine thier survivability in enduring attacks, while weapon light level shows how effective a guardian can be against enemy combatants. These two should not be intertwined as to how players decide to challenge themselves is up to them. The recommended level is the only thing that should matter. What tools/weapons a person see is at thier own descretion.
[b]Raid gear[/b]
Should have predetermined armor levels that are a stepping stone to allowing most players to transition through to thier next levels at the point where they are able to raid. It should all be upgradable to the most current light level. The raid should feel somewhat necessary to get to the next level.
This also means across the board drops can be improved so players can use them to level up their lower level gear. More playing for more marks and more drops to use as upgrade materials. Players then feel much more rewarded for their efforts.
